AAPL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2018 in Review

3,040 of the 4,489 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Apple (AAPL) for Q4 2018, worth a combined $444B — down 31% from $645B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 371 funds opened new AAPL positions and 136 closed out — a net gain of 235 holders — while 1,263 added to existing stakes and 1,227 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Susquehanna International Group, adding an estimated $2.91B. The largest seller was Cornerstone Wealth Management, cutting an estimated $2.77B.
